[QUOTE="SidecarFlip, post: 875772, member: 39764"] Interesting. I had a Redding and sold it BTW. I presume the Redding and the Lyman both use an insert pilot that goes in the neck to align the case for trimming... If so, are you using the correct pilot? I typed out a rather long reply and lost it. Sometimes this site irritates me...:) Some questions that will allow us to deduce whats happening other than too big of a pilot on your trimmer... 1. What brand is the brass? 2. How many times have you loaded them? 3. Are your dies bushing dies or fixed cavity dies? 4. What position is the expander ball in, high or low? 5. Do you FL size or Neck size? Don't worry about the bolt blowing back, it won't no matter how much overpressure/overcharge you have. All modern receivers have cross drilled vent holes to let an overpressure out if the case fails. You will probably uchre the action but you won't rearrange your face. Something is fishy ir you are Charlie Atlas when you close your bolt....:D [/QUOTE]
